17/11/2024 Football Gossip & News

  • Manchester City are increasingly confident that Norwegian striker Erling Haaland, 24, will sign a lucrative new deal that would make him the Premier League’s top earner. (Mirror, external)
  • West Ham are considering a move for Manchester City’s English midfielder James McAtee, 22, as they prepare for the possible January departure of Brazilian forward Lucas Paqueta, 27. (Sun, external)
  • Ruud van Nistelrooy is targeting a Premier League managerial role after being devastated by his departure from Manchester United. (Mirror, external)
  • The future of Luton Town manager Rob Edwards is uncertain, with Coventry City monitoring developments closely. (Sun, external)
  • Aston Villa manager Unai Emery aims to strengthen his defence in January by signing Spain centre-back Diego Llorente, 31, from Real Betis. However, the defender’s long-term contract may complicate the deal. (Football Insider, external)
  • Aston Villa are also leading the race to sign Athletic Bilbao’s Spanish attacking midfielder Oihan Sancet, 24, but are debating whether to meet his €80m (£66.9m) release clause. (Caught Offside, external)
  • Juventus are eyeing a move for Manchester United’s Dutch striker Joshua Zirkzee, 23, as the future of their Serbian forward Dusan Vlahovic, 24, remains uncertain. (CalcioMercato – in Italian, external)
  • Nigeria striker Victor Osimhen, currently on loan at Galatasaray, will be available in the summer for €75m (£62.7m) due to a release clause in the 25-year-old’s Napoli contract. (La Gazzetta dello Sport – in Italian, external)
  • Newcastle United may consider selling Swedish forward Alexander Isak, 25, to fund the purchase of a world-class replacement. (Football Insider, external)
  • Germany centre-back Jonathan Tah, 28, will not renew his contract with Bayer Leverkusen. A free transfer to Bayern Munich or Barcelona next summer is considered a “concrete option”. (Sky Sports Germany, external)
  • Paris St-Germain defender Milan Skriniar, 29, is open to a return to Italy with Juventus, as he struggles for playing time at the French club. (La Gazzetta dello Sport – in Italian, external)
